Change the Filter in Your HVAC System

Your HVAC system has many components integral to its effective and efficient operation. Most you can only access with professional help. But the filter in your HVAC system is easily accessible, and for a good reason. To prevent clogs that strain your HVAC system and cause higher energy and repair costs, you must check your HVAC system’s filter every month. Hold it up to the light. If it looks dirty, replace it. Never go more than 90 days between filter changes.

Switch the Rotation of Your Ceiling Fans

As the outdoor temperature in Hagerstown heats up, you’ll start to use your air conditioner. The more you can reduce your reliance on your AC system, the better for your energy costs and the environment. During the cooling season, make sure your ceiling fans rotate in a counterclockwise direction. This will create a wind-chill effect that can make a room feel up to 8 degrees cooler, which helps you use your AC system less. Turn off ceiling fans in empty rooms.
